Keep in mind, the policies under the Ontario Employment Requirement Act concerning discontinuation and severance pay are a company's minimum requirements. You may have greater rights that surpass minimal repayments. Some terminated workers select to file a lawsuit against their company for such things as wrongful dismissal or useful termination. The complying with defines the amount of notification needed under the Work Specification Act: No notice when an employee has actually been used for under three months, One week's notice in contacting the employee if his or her duration of work is much less than one year, Two weeks' notification in contacting the worker if his or her duration of employment is one year or more but much less than 3 years, Three weeks' notification in contacting the worker if his or her duration of employment is three years or even more however much less than four years, 4 weeks' notice in contacting the staff member if his or her period of employment is 4 years or more yet much less than 5 years, 5 weeks' notification in creating to the employee if his/her duration of employment is 5 years or even more but less than six years, 6 weeks' notice in contacting the employee if his or her period of employment is six years or more however less than seven years, Seven weeks' notification in contacting the staff member if his/her period of employment is seven years or even more yet less than 8 years, 8 weeks' notice in contacting the staff member if his/her duration of employment is eight years or more It is important to recognize that termination pay is an amount paid by an employer pursuant to minimum criteria regulation it is not discontinuance wage, nor is it payment for wrongful termination.What is Discontinuance Wage in Ontario? Severance pay seems to be a "catch-all" term for discontinuation pay, yet it is, actually, something different. Severance pay is a statutory settlement that is made by the employer upon termination of an employee, in enhancement to any statutory private notification of termination as well as team termination notice (or pay in lieu of such notice).

What prevails Legislation Settlement in Lieu of Notice? In every non-unionized employment connection, an employer has an implied common legislation commitment to offer the employee sensible notice of its intent to end the employment connection, unless there is just create for termination. The affordable notification duration is a duration in enhancement to, but includes the minimum statutory discontinuation notification duration as well as the time period covered by legal severance pay.
Usual regulation sensible notice is The main function of sensible notification of your discontinuation is to give you, as the staff member, a possibility and an affordable amount of time to look for various other employment. The reasonable notification duration is established by referral to variables such as the your character of employment; your size of solution; your age; and the schedule of comparable work, having respect to your experience, training, and also certifications. The 2nd action is to determine the your damages over the practical notification period.
An employer might offer your severance in a round figure payout to please its notice responsibilities. employment lawyer consultation. A payment for repayment in lieu of notice is thought about payment for violation of the implied commitment to give proper notification of discontinuation, although in legislation, the quantum of compensation amounts the called for size of working notification.

In Ontario, there is legal minimum notice which need to be provided which an employer can not acquire itself out of. There is additionally usual legislation notice which is termination pay or settlement in lieu of notification is dramatically more that the suggested legal minimum notification. A company has 2 options when providing an employee with sensible notification of his or her termination. The company can either need the staff member to continue working for the amount of time till his or her termination or, give the worker with settlement instead of that notice.
